mwbr.net
当前位置:首页 >> js mousEout >>

js mousEout

donload = function(){ document.getElementById("dd").onmouseout = function(e){ e = e || window.event; var x = e.relatedTarget || e.toElement; console.log(x); }} dddd

angularjs中有ng-mouseout吗? 我只知道js中 mouseleave只对指定的元素生效(只有离开指定元素时才触发) mouseout对指定元素及其子元素生效(离开指定元素及子元素都触发)

用个DIV套住它们,把行间事件写在这个DIV上。 mouseover测试 显示 隐藏内容

利用类似如下的方式 function demoMouseOver(obj) { if(...) { obj.onmouseout = function(){demoMouseOut(this);}; } else { obj.onmouseout = function() {return false;}; }}function demoMouseOut(obj) { //do something}

话说有一个DIV元素,其内部有一个IMG元素和SPAN元素,不用理会这两个内部元素怎么布局,这不是我要讨论的重点。 为了实现一些特殊的效果,我需要利用TD的...

你可以在每次绑定之前先解绑原来的事件 $("#img").unbind("mouseout").bind("mouseout",function(){....});

你这逻辑有点问题,或者表达有点问题, 问:如果当边框为蓝色时,鼠标放上去为红色,此时点击的话,边框是否变回蓝色? 答: 不变,保留红色,此时属于你的附加条件,不应该有mouseout事件,那mouseover是否需要,需要的话有属于mouseover事件,...

function mouseOver(){ document.getElementById("editpass").style.backgroundImage="url('../media/images/2.gif')"; } function mouseOut(){ document.getElementById("editpass").style.backgroundImage="url('../media/images/3.gif')"; }...

在事件最后加上e.stopPropagation();就好

这就是一个阻止冒泡,你搜出来的那个是jq里面封装的阻止冒泡的方法,很好用,js里面相对来说复杂很多 function stopPropagation(e) { e = e || window....

网站首页 | 网站地图
All rights reserved Powered by www.mwbr.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com